Trabalho de banco de dados

931 palavras 4 páginas
Scripts de criação e popularização das tabelas:

CREATE TABLE Ficha
(
id_ficha smallint NOT NULL
, data datetime NOT NULL
, LojaID int NOT NULL
, IDV int NOT NULL
, CPF int NOT NULL
, Chassi varchar(20) NOT NULL
, CodPag int NOT NULL
, Seq int NOT NULL
, CONSTRAINT pk_fichaori PRIMARY KEY (id_ficha)
, CONSTRAINT FK_Ficha FOREIGN KEY(LojaID)
REFERENCES Loja(id_loja)
, CONSTRAINT FK_Ficha2 FOREIGN KEY(IDV)
REFERENCES Vendedor(id_vend)
, CONSTRAINT FK_Ficha3 FOREIGN KEY(CPF)
REFERENCES Cliente(CPF)
, CONSTRAINT FK_Ficha4 FOREIGN KEY(Chassi)
REFERENCES Veiculo(Chassi)
, CONSTRAINT FK_Ficha5 FOREIGN KEY(Seq)
REFERENCES CondPag(id_Seq)
)
INSERT INTO Ficha
VALUES (1,'20091009',1,1,' 07234512342','GHF42142F42445434564',1)
INSERT INTO Ficha
VALUES (2,'20101009',2,2,' 07234513454','GHF42142F40908976565',2)
INSERT INTO Ficha
VALUES (3,'20111009',1,1,' 07234555555','GHF42142F44737362738',3)
INSERT INTO Ficha
VALUES (4,'20081009',1,1,' 07234666663','GHF42142F44638292766',4)
INSERT INTO Ficha
VALUES (5,'20071009',1,1,' 07234434323','GHF42142F49483726450',5)

CREATE TABLE Loja
(
id_loja int NOT NULL
, NomeLoja varchar(50) NOT NULL
, CONSTRAINT pk_ficha PRIMARY KEY (id_loja)
)
INSERT INTO Loja
VALUES (1,'Store1')
INSERT INTO Loja
VALUES (2,'Store2')
INSERT INTO Loja
VALUES (3,'Store3')
INSERT INTO Loja
VALUES (4,'Store4')
INSERT INTO Loja
VALUES (5,'Store5')

CREATE TABLE Cliente
(
cpf int NOT NULL
, NomeCliente varchar(50) NOT NULL
, idCid int not null
, IdUF int NOT NULL
, Cep int NOT NULL
, endereco varchar(50) NOT NULL
, CONSTRAINT pk_cliente PRIMARY KEY (cpf)
, CONSTRAINT fk_cliente FOREIGN KEY(IdCid)
REFERENCES Cidade(id_cid)
, CONSTRAINT fk_cliente2 FOREIGN KEY(IdUF)
REFERENCES UF(id_UF)
)

INSERT INTO Cliente
VALUES (07234512342,'Rafael',1,1,30410410,'Rua Ametista 333')
INSERT INTO Cliente
VALUES (07234513454,'Amanda',1,1,30410420,'Rua Rubi 444')
INSERT INTO Cliente
VALUES

Relacionados

  • Trabalho banco dados
    2238 palavras | 9 páginas
  • trabalho banco de dados
    2380 palavras | 10 páginas
  • Trabalho De Banco De Dados
    1461 palavras | 6 páginas
  • Trabalho Banco de Dados
    2049 palavras | 9 páginas
  • Trabalho banco de dados
    2228 palavras | 9 páginas
  • Trabalho de banco de dados
    2083 palavras | 9 páginas
  • Trabalho banco de dados
    3810 palavras | 16 páginas
  • TRABALHO BANCO DE DADOS
    334 palavras | 2 páginas
  • Banco de Dados Trabalho
    1863 palavras | 8 páginas
  • Trabalho Banco de Dados
    833 palavras | 4 páginas